Suggestions for Charleston SC Campgrounds

I would like to travel to the Charlston South Carolina Area.
I am looking for any suggestions of nice campgrounds preferrable on or near the water.

We stay in Charleston two months each year at Oak Plantation Campground. It is very well maintained, clean facilitiest and close to the city. There is another nice county campground on James Island but they don't have the improved roads and ability to stay a month at a time like Oak Plantation. You will enjoy your visit to Charleston. It's one of the best cities in the South with lots to do.

best place to camp on the ocean

The best place to camp on the ocean near Charleston that I know of is Edisto Beach State Park. They have water and electric sites right at the beach or on the salt marsh. This location is about an hour drive to down town Charleston.

Not too far away, but another "must see" place, is Hunting Island State Park. It is south of Beaufort, SC. The state park has campsites right on the ocean and there is a historic lighthouse too. Climbing to the top of the lighthouse, you can see for miles. Also, visit the ruins of Old Sheldon Church.

James Island County Park

We've stayed at James Island County park twice. It's one of our favorite campgrounds. It's about 15 minutes from Charleston. There's actually a shuttle that you can ride into town from the campground. Beautiful park!!

We recommend the KOA campground on US 17, just north of Mt. Pleasant. It has nice sites on a lake with pool, etc. It is very convenient to downtown Charleston. Seacure, 27-foot Overlander, 07 Yukon 6.2.
